About the Role

We are seeking a highly experienced and skilled Senior Director to lead our Health Equity Program at FrameWorks Institute. The successful candidate will be responsible for establishing and building the Program, setting its strategic direction, and leading engagement with partners to achieve impact.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ain the strategic direction for the health equity program, ensuring alignment with the field and the organization's mission.
  • Map the health equity field and maintain relationships with key partners, agencies, and individuals.
  • Partner with the Director of Research to set the research agenda for the Program.
  • Be accountable for the program's application and communications activities, ensuring quality, consistency, and appropriateness for the field.
  • Manage the day-to-day operations of the Program, ensuring integration, alignment with Program strategy, and meeting Program goals.
  • Oversee project management activities, including developing and managing workplans for engagement, application, and communications work.
  • Lead the FrameWorks team's participation in the Health Equity Mindsets Initiative Consortium project within the Health Equity Program.
  • Present Program findings to partners, funders, and other stakeholders.
  • Work with the Director of Development to identify and secure additional funding for the Program.
  • Lead the process of reporting on the work of the Program to its funders.
  • Manage the work of program staff, collaborating with staff members' supervisors to ensure high-quality work that advances program goals.
  • Serve as a member of FrameWorks' Management Team and provide leadership and strategic insights on organizational work, direction, policies, and operations.
Requirements
  • Twelve or more years of combined education and professional experience in the health equity field, with at least 10 years of education and experience above the undergraduate level.
  • Five years of management experience.
  • Deep knowledge of and existing relationships with key organizations, agencies, and individuals in the health equity field.
  • Demonstrated experience using framing/narrative to achieve social change.
  • Ability to learn, shape, and interpret FrameWorks' research and recommendations.
  • Demonstrated ability to achieve impact in their work.
  • Demonstrated experience integrating principles of equity, justice, and inclusion into daily work.
  • High emotional intelligence.
  • Experience working collaboratively on a diverse team.
What We Offer

FrameWorks Institute offers a competitive salary range of $140,000 to $200,000, depending on experience. Key benefits include 4 weeks paid vacation leave per year, 21 days of holiday leave, paid sick leave and personal leave, 403(b) retirement plan, 100% employer-paid health insurance, life and disability insurance, flexible spending plan, cell phone and internet reimbursement, and professional development funding.
